Cold Room Insulation: Boosting Energy Reduction
Proper thermal barrier for cold rooms is vital to reaching significant energy reduction. A poorly thermal protected room deals with higher heat leakage, forcing the chiller to operate longer and expend power. Choosing the right insulation type – such as spray foam – and ensuring sufficient application are necessary steps in lowering operational costs and reducing your environmental impact. Regular examination of the existing shielding can also reveal potential breaches and permit timely corrections.
The Importance of Cooling for Food Preservation
Preserving the optimal temperature is fundamentally vital for successful food preservation . Previously, ways relied on smoking, but contemporary solutions increasingly involve cooling . Lowering the development of dangerous bacteria significantly enhances storage period and lessens the risk of foodborne disease .
